Output 886c6048b2b8ad904e1b7f0f19a17ec6a850266ae4e5d7f84e5519b0203ea859:0

value
590796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234c8a04b40d92e7925e2466aa631f36b938976c OP_EQUAL
address
34ufGHn9QQNmpKPcH4mtyBpXvgBSPu6nZV
transaction
886c6048b2b8ad904e1b7f0f19a17ec6a850266ae4e5d7f84e5519b0203ea859
confirmations
292487
spent
true